Ego the Living Planet was initially introduced in The Mighty Thor #132 (September 1966), and was created by Jack Kirby. Kirby created Ego as a way of exploring his fascination with the expanse of the universe. Ego, the alien Kree, and The Colonizers immediately followed the creation of Galactus, thus establishing Marvel Comics' own "space age mythology".
